Studies in forestry : being a short course of lectures on the principles of sylviculture delivered at the Botanic Garden, Oxford during the Hilary and Michaelmas terms, 1893 /

The author applies experience obtained in German economic forestry to how such methods might work in Britain, and covers areas including: nutrition and food supplies; soil and situation; mixed timber crops; formation and generation of woodland crops; crop maintenance; underplanting; soil conservatio...
